Product Description

The Schwalbe Big Betty tire is a top - notch mountain and downhill tire. Measuring 29 x 2.4 inches with a black color, it's a tubeless folding tire from the Evolution Line with an Addix Soft compound for super gravity. This tire offers all the latest in modern tire technology. It's a great all - rounder for downhill and enduro, performing well in dry to damp conditions. When paired with the popular Magic Mary on the front, it works perfectly on the rear wheel. Key features include long supported braking edges for maximum traction when braking, extremely stable shoulder blocks for excellent cornering grip, and an open and aggressive tread pattern that provides great grip and self - cleaning ability. Technical specs: Color - Black, Flat Protection - Sidewall, ISO Diameter - 622 / Road / 29', ISO Width (mm) - 61, Tire Bead - Folding, Tire Type - Tubeless Ready Clincher, and intended for mountain and downhill use.
